t-bar lift or lift kit wouldn't have an effect on the half shafts breaking....could cause wear in the cv-joint, but breaking a half shaft would take a lot more stress than a simple t-bar lift. I have never heard of a haf shaft breaking on the h3...hell hall racing used stock half shafts in their baja h3 and never broke one.....this is kinda strange.
